As to color, I've been enjoying exploring for new combinations -- and have found a big dose of inspiration at the the Pantone website. The site itself is a great bit of eye candy, and was fun poking around.

They've produced, in pdf format, two beautifully designed reports that showcase spring and fall colors with accompanying commentary by designers like Zac Posen.

Even the names they've given their colors were sumptuous: violet infused hollyhock, diaphanous silver peony, gleaming green sheen, ...

If you are looking for color inspiration for spring -- or even fall, this is a great site.
